Description

Hol Horse is a minor recurring antagonist featured in Stardust Crusaders. Hol Horse is a mercenary wielding Emperor, a Stand that looks like, and functions similarly to, a gun. He was originally sent by DIO to confront the Joestar Group alongside J. Geil. However, after his partner is defeated first, he makes a tactical retreat, returning for two following encounters. He first reappears caught in the cross fire of Enya the Hag's own attempt to kill the Joestar Group and one last time to attack them himself alongside Boingo, finally being defeated in the latter encounter. Hol Horse is a man of above-average height and medium build. At his back, he has light, neck-length hair. He has dimples in his cheeks and a cleft chin. He wears mostly light-colored clothes with a dark undershirt and a wide-brimmed hat from which hang two long, thin, loose straps; and a loose, sleeveless top or a type of poncho, hanging below his waist in a rectangle of the fabric of mid-thigh length. His clothing resembles that of a cowboy from a Western but is distinctly different at the same time. First appearing as seemingly confident and smooth-talking with women, Hol Horse looks and acts like a stereotypical movie gunslinger. However, whenever he is at a disadvantage, his cowardice surfaces. As a henchman for DIO, Hol Horse's confidence fluctuates significantly. Unlike many overconfident Stand users, Hol Horse is primarily aware of how weak his Stand, Emperor, is when compared to most Stands. This knowledge combined with his affable personality (since he has no problem being a second-in-command rather than a "Number 1") makes him willing to partner up with someone else. In that case, Hol Horse is very confident that he can take on anyone. This confidence extends to whenever he can convince himself that he has the advantage, which leads to his assassination attempt on DIO with a calm determination the vampire complimented and deemed enough to prevail against the Joestar Group. On the other hand, if Hol Horse sees that he doesn't have the upper hand, he reveals his cowardly self and doesn't hesitate to flee in the face of danger. Hol Horse fled twice, for this reason; first when he learned that J. Geil was killed, and secondly when he saw the opportunity of stealing the Joestar Group's 4x4. Still, Hol Horse has a lingering pride and his first reflex, as seen against Enya the Hag and DIO, is to put up a fight if ridiculed. Hol Horse considers himself a ladies' man. By his word, he has girlfriends from all over the world, but reveals that he seduces them to make use of them later rather than from any romantic feelings. Although he almost always lies to women, Hol Horse is against hitting them. He vehemently denied Tohth's prediction of him kicking a lady from behind would come to pass, as he had sworn never to hit women. This prediction is proven later out of Hol Horse's own compulsion, though he kicked the woman to save her from a deadly scorpion. This moral standard didn't prevent Hol Horse from pointing his Stand at Enya. However, that was out of self-defense as the latter had blamed Hol Horse for her son's death and refused to listen to reason. Hol Horse has a greedy personality, carrying out assassinations for money, and the possibility of taking DIO's treasures was one motivation for his attempt to kill DIO.
